常见的和常 JSON 格式
除了基本的对象和数组结构,由于其简单易读的见格特点,布尔值(boolean)、字符我们经常需要在 JSON 字符串和 JavaScript 对象之间进行转换。示例式
和常企业生产计划云服务器排程优化软件键和值之间用冒号 : 分隔。见格同时也易于机器解析和生成。字符// 将 JSON 字符串转换为 JavaScript 对象const obj = JSON.parse('{"name":"John Doe",示例式"age":30}');console.log(obj.name); // 输出: "John Doe"// 将 JavaScript 对象转换为 JSON 字符串const json = JSON.stringify({name: "John Doe", age: 30});console.log(json); // 输出: '{"name":"John Doe","age":30}'
JSON 在应用中的应用
JSON 格式广泛应用于网络应用程序中的数据交换,可以包含字符串、和常可以更好地理解和应用这种数据交换格式。JSON 数据还可以包含以下基本数据类型:字符串(string)、对象内部是由逗号分隔的键值对,它由对象和数组两种基本结构组成,JSON 已经成为 XML 的替代者,布尔值和 null 等基本数据类型。对象由一对花括号 { } 包围,例如 RESTful API 返回的数据、具有易于人阅读和编写、
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,
JSON 字符串的示例
下面是一个简单的 JSON 字符串示例:
{ "name": "John Doe", "age": 30, "email": "johndoe@example.com"}
这个 JSON 字符串包含了一个对象,成为当前最流行的数据交换格式之一。使数据交互成为一种可能。数组内部是由逗号分隔的值。数组由一对方括号 [ ] 包围。配置文件等。数字(number)、已经成为当前最流行的数据交换格式之一。JSON 在各种网络应用程序中广泛应用,
此外,数字、通过学习 JSON 字符串的示例和常见格式, AJAX 请求的响应、 JSON 采用完全独立于语言的文本格式,易于机器解析和生成的特点。null。
总结
JSON 是一种轻量级的数据交换格式,JSON 还有以下一些常见的格式:
// 数组["apple", "banana", "cherry"]// 嵌套对象{ "person": { "name": "John Doe", "age": 30 }, "address": { "street": "123 Main St", "city": "Anytown", "state": "CA" }}// 数组套对象[ { "name": "John Doe", "age": 30 }, { "name": "Jane Smith", "age": 25 }]// 键值对的值可以是任意类型{ "name": "John Doe", "age": 30, "isStudent": true, "hobbies": ["reading", "swimming", "traveling"], "address": null}
JSON 字符串的转换
在实际应用中,
JSON 字符串的基本结构
JSON 数据由两种结构组成:对象(object)和数组(array)。